Last week, a top ER doctor at a Manhattan hospital, Dr. Lorna M. Breen, died by suicide. Dr. Breen had been on the front lines of the coronavirus pandemic and treated many patients at the Manhattan hospital.
Dr. Breen had also contracted and recovered from the virus herself. Dr. Breen’s suicide was an unfortunate wake-up call, particularly for mental health professionals.
It begs the question — what are we doing, and what do we plan to do, to take care of the mental health of our frontline and essential workers?
